As a Project Manager at TAG you will...
- Act as the primary point of contact between TAG and your clients by establishing strong relationships with your clients.
- Establish strong relationships with internal teams and client stakeholders to ensure smooth collaboration and communication.
- Develop and manage detailed project documentation, including timelines, project plans, meeting notes, and budget trackers for projects typically up to $200k.
- Support project scoping by gathering requirements and translating them into actionable tasks.
- Manage project execution from kickoff through launch, ensuring deliverables are completed on time, within budget, and to TAG’s quality standards.
- Forecast and manage project resources in alignment with budgets, schedules, and team capacity.
- Monitor project health and proactively identify and escalate potential risks or blockers before they impact delivery.
- Collaborate closely with design, strategy, development, and QA teams to maintain alignment and momentum throughout the project lifecycle.
- Participate in QA reviews to help ensure deliverables meet project requirements and quality expectations.
- Lead recurring project meetings, including internal check-ins, client status meetings, and milestone reviews.
- Provide clear, consistent communication to internal leadership and clients regarding progress, risks, and next steps.
- Contribute to continuous improvement by sharing feedback, lessons learned, and ideas to enhance team processes and delivery efficiency.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ene
Key Facts About Boston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
-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
